Web11 apr. 2024 · If you notice moldavite pieces that seem to be the same shapes, it's probably not a real piece. Other fake moldavite details need to be observed up close and personal. Real moldavite is rough, jagged, and different shapes. Fake rough moldavite looks wet, have similar shapes, and is flat. Web10 feb. 2024 · Just as it is hard to polish into a smooth stone, it is also difficult to find a legit moldavite that is completely clear all throughout. A legit moldavite is made of silica, but it comes with lots of impurities such as iron and magnesium that can make it a bit unclear than a clear stone such as diamond.
